   * [http://www.winafp.com WinAFP] (commercial) is a great tool to inspect AFP 
files and to manually modify them. Content folding allows to quickly scan 
through large files. It runs on Microsoft Windows.
  
+  * [http://www.btbnet.de/wps/portal/AFP-Tools BTB Browser] is another AFP 
viewer which is probably better suited for preview than IBM's tools as it 
doesn't replace bitmap fonts with platform fonts. It also has a good AFP 
decoder useful for debugging.

  == Tips for developing with AFP ==
  
  MO``:DCA & Co. have grown over time but the specifications usually don't tell 
if a particular feature is an old or new feature. There are still a lot of 
AFP/IPDS environments around which only support a very old version and only 
bi-level printing. Relying on just the AFP Workbench has proven to be 
insufficient as this viewer supports a lot of features and is quite lenient 
about what you do in AFP. Furthermore, fonts are painted using operating system 
outline fonts even if you specify bitmap fonts in your print files. Obviously, 
the best way to test is having an older IPDS laser printer around but there you 
have the problem that you get non-helpful error messages if something's wrong. 
Additional, unfortunately commercial, viewer applications can help further 
during debugging. AFP dumpers like AFPAN (see above) are also a very important 
source for information. It is quite sensitive to mistakes. Rule number one: 
Test in as many environments as possible. No single tool will be 
 able to tell you that the file you produced is correct and works in most 
environments.
